基质金属蛋白酶-9在脑膜瘤复发和残瘤生长中表达的意义 被引量:1

Expression of matrix metalloproteinase-9 and its significance in meningioma recurrence and regrowth

摘要 目的探讨基质金属蛋白酶-9(MMP-9)的表达在颅内脑膜瘤患者经手术治疗后复发和残瘤生长中的意义。方法选择因复发或残瘤生长而进行手术的脑膜瘤患者44例(71个脑膜瘤标本)做为实验组,同期非复发性脑膜瘤患者30例(30个脑膜瘤标本)做为对照组,应用Envision免疫组化法检测脑膜瘤MMP-9的表达,分析不同手术次数、切除程度和病理分级间肿瘤MMP-9表达及患者无进展生存期(RFS)的差异。结果实验组患者脑膜瘤MMP-9表达高于对照组,差异有统计学意义(P〈0.05),并且实验组中手术次数越多,患者MMP-9表达有增高趋势;与WHOI级脑膜瘤患者比较,WHOⅡ级患者MMP-9表达增高,RFS降低,差异有统计学意义(P〈0.05)。结论MMP-9的高表达可能参与脑膜瘤的复发和残瘤生长过程。 Objective To investigate the expression of matrix metalloproteinase-9 (MMP-9) and determine the biologic significance of MMP-9 in the meningioma recurrence and regrowth after surgery. Methods The expression level of MMP-9 were examined by immunohistochemistry (Envision method) in 74 patients with meningioma, including 30 with primary meningioma without recurrence (control), and 44 with meningioma recurrence and regrowth after surgery (71 samples, experimental). The relation between recurrence-free survival (RFS) and the expression of MMP-9 in different grades of meningioma with different operation frequency and resection degree was analyzed in these 101 samples. Results The mean expression of MMP-9 in the experimental group was significantly higher as compared with that in the control group (P〈0.05); increased expression of MMP-9 was found following the increase of operation frequency in the experimental group; no obviously decreased expression of MMP-9 was found following the increase of recession degree in the experimental group, but the expression of MMP-9 in patients with grade II meningioma was significantly increased than that in patients with grade I meningioma and the RFS was statistically decreased (P〈0.05). Conclusion MMP-9 may be involved in recurrence and regrowth of grade II meningioma, and increased expression of MMP-9 can be considered as an indicator for a high risk of recurrence and regrowth ofmeningioma.
